Aave DAO has initiated a governance proposal to deprecate 75 isolated reserves and six associated deployments across its lending protocol. The move directly affects $98.1 million in supplied assets and $15.6 million in outstanding debt, with the stated goal of consolidating liquidity and reducing operational complexity.
The proposal, submitted by the Aave Risk DAO, identifies the targeted reserves as having consistently low utilization and minimal trading activity. Maintaining these illiquid markets incurs unnecessary oracle costs and monitoring overhead. Most of the targeted assets are long-tail tokens with dwindling on-chain liquidity.
The deprecation process runs in two phases. First, reserves will be frozen, blocking new deposits and borrowing. Second, a subsequent governance vote will delist the assets entirely. Users holding positions in affected reserves will need to migrate their capital.
Suppliers in the affected reserves will no longer earn interest or use those assets as collateral once frozen. Borrowers retain their debt but face pressure to repay or refinance before full delisting. The proposal includes a transition period to minimize disruption.
The $98.1 million represents less than 1.5 percent of Aave's total supplied capital. Aave V3, the protocol's primary deployment, currently holds over $7.5 billion in TVL across multiple chains.
The 75 reserves span several deployments, including legacy Aave V2 instances on Ethereum and Polygon. Specific assets include RUNE, DPI and older stablecoin variants—markets that have seen no material activity for several quarters.
Liquidity providers in deprecated pools will need to withdraw their funds, potentially routing stablecoins and other assets back into more active Aave markets or broader circulation.
The proposal is currently in the snapshot phase, allowing AAVE token holders to signal support. If it passes, it proceeds to an on-chain vote requiring a majority of staked AAVE for execution.
The primary risk is liquidation exposure for borrowers who fail to repay before full delisting. Sudden volatility in affected long-tail assets could accelerate that risk, though Aave's existing risk parameters are designed to manage orderly wind-downs.
Removing underutilized reserves shrinks the protocol's attack surface and frees resources for core development and risk management on higher-demand markets. Compound and MakerDAO have run similar reserve-pruning processes as their protocols matured.
